
Ci&T Inc. (CINT) highlighted its strategic focus on AI integration at Citi’s 2025 Global Technology, Media and Telecommunications Conference, noting AI's impact on 85-90% of its revenue via the CINT Flow platform. The company is actively reskilling its workforce and leveraging AI to drive market share growth by replacing competitors, viewing AI as expansionary for value-based services despite its deflationary effect on volume-based offerings. Ci&T maintains stable utilization and low attrition, and plans to pursue R&D, share repurchases, and M&A, particularly in the U.S., focusing on acquiring companies with large customer bases.
Ci&T Inc. (NYSE:CINT) presented a clear strategic focus on leveraging its proprietary CINT Flow platform to drive growth through AI integration. According to CEO Cesar Gon, this platform is already deeply embedded, impacting 85-90% of revenue and differentiating the firm in a stable but competitive IT services market. The company is not relying on expanding client budgets but is actively targeting market share from competitors less prepared for the AI shift. Management views AI as expansionary for its value-added services, such as customer experience renovation and legacy modernization, while acknowledging its deflationary impact on commoditized, volume-based work. Financially, the company maintains a healthy utilization rate of 85-89% and attributes its low attrition to a strong AI-centric value proposition for its workforce. While 2025 revenue guidance is secured by committed contracts, future growth hinges on pipeline conversion. Capital allocation priorities include R&D for the CINT Flow platform, a continued stock repurchase program, and a renewed focus on M&A, specifically targeting US-based firms with large customer accounts that offer global expansion potential.
